Hi Vito et all, > My suggestion is (still) to have somebody from the SUN team write this > up as a BAS and add > the result to the testtool. > My suggestion is still to get a portal inside OOo, where all TestTool results are collected. Then a comparison is possible between different platforms, languages and versions. Only this bring the feedback you needed. If you run a test with 20 errors and 50 warnings, does not say anything. Because all tests should run without any error! Each other result needs analysis, and this is only possible with a comparison in such a database or with the result files of the testcase. And as I often wrote, the resources in Sun QA are very limited. We will provide a mentor for this project, but the work have to be done by the community. This was a project at the last Google Summer of Code, but it wasn't accepted. Then it was discussed on last OOoCon in Lyon and after that it doesn't have any priority. So if you need such tooling, find someone who can realize this project. Thorsten
